Description

Oxoglaucine is a naturally occurring isoquinoline alkaloid derivative, recognized for its significant role as a key intermediate in advanced pharmaceutical synthesis and biochemical research. Its unique molecular structure makes it a valuable building block for developing novel therapeutic agents and conducting structure-activity relationship (SAR) studies. This high-purity compound is essential for research and development laboratories in the pharmaceutical, biotechnology, and fine chemical sectors, particularly those focused on neuropharmacology and natural product chemistry.

Basic Information

Item Detail
Product Name Oxoglaucine
CAS No. 5574-24-3
Molecular Formula C19H19NO4
Molecular Weight 325.36 g/mol
Synonyms Oxoglaucine; 5,6,6a,7-Tetrahydro-1,2,10-trimethoxy-6-methyl-4H-dibenzo[de,g]quinoline-4,9(11H)-dione; Glaucine-9-one; 1,2,10-Trimethoxy-6-methyl-5,6,6a,7-tetrahydro-4H-dibenzo[de,g]quinoline-4,9(11H)-dione; NSC 51046; (+)-Oxoglaucine
